KJV Lexicon
If I have made
suwm  (soom)
to put (used in a great variety of applications, literal, figurative, inferentially, and elliptically)wholly, work.
gold
zahab  (zaw-hawb')
gold, figuratively, something gold-colored (i.e. yellow), as oil, a clear sky -- gold(-en), fair weather.
my hope
kecel  (keh'-sel)
fatness, i.e. by implication (literally) the loin (as the seat of the leaf fat) or (generally) the viscera; also (figuratively) silliness or (in a good sense) trust
or have said
'amar  (aw-mar')
to say (used with great latitude)
to the fine gold
kethem  (keh'-them)
something carved out, i.e. ore; hence, gold (pure as originally mined) -- (most) fine, pure) gold(-en wedge).
Thou art my confidence
mibtach  (mib-tawkh')
a refuge, i.e. (objective) security, or (subjective) assurance -- confidence, hope, sure, trust.
